Opinion

PER CURIAM.

Graham Paye was the plaintiff and counter-defendant in a divorce action below and appeals that portion of the final decree in which the lower court awarded custody of the child to the defendant and counter-plaintiff, Helen L. Paye.

We have read the briefs of the parties and the testimony adduced below and find no error in the trial judge’s decision.

Affirmed.

ALLEN, Acting C. J., WHITE, J., and WILLIS, ROBERT, Associate Judge, concur.
